Authorities on scene of hazmat situation that sends father and daughter to the hospital

Wednesday, January 31, 2018
SANGER, Calif. (KFSN) -- There is a hard closure now in effect at Highway 180 and Bethel after a van collided with an agriculture tank containing sulfuric acid. It happened just after 7:30 Wednesday morning when a man driving the van lost control hitting the tank.



He and his daughter were splashed with some of the acid and were taken to a hospital for burn treatment.

There is now a hazmat situation in the area as acid seeps into the ground.

County health officials are on scene to drain the tank of all the sulfuric acid.

An investigation is now underway to determine what caused the crash.
